HB23-1191 - Referred to the Committee of the Whole - Consent Calendar


02:00:55 PM  
Senator Fields, sponsor, presented House Bill 23-1191, which concerns prohibiting corporal punishment of children in certain public settings. She provided opening comments on the bill.
02:05:50 PM  
Dr. Lora Melnicoe, representing the American Academy of Pediatrics, Colorado Chapter, testified in support of the bill.
02:09:46 PM  
Jen Walmer, representing Democrats for Education Reform, testified in support of the bill.
02:12:01 PM  
Jillian Fabricius, representing Illuminate Colorado, testified in support of the bill.
02:22:54 PM  
Dawn Fritz, representing Colorado Parent Teacher Association, testified in support of the bill.

SB23-029 - Amended, referred to Senate Appropriations


02:28:51 PM  
Senator Moreno, sponsor, presented Senate Bill 23-029, which concerns addressing disproportionate discipline in public schools. He provided opening comments on the bill and distributed and explained amendment L.001 (Attachment A).
02:32:14 PM  
Senator Moreno answered questions from the committee. Committee members made comments.
02:36:03 PM  
Paul Gilbert, representing himself, testified in opposition to the bill.
02:40:35 PM  
Michelle Murphy,
representing Colorado Rural Schools Alliance, Colorado Association of School
Executives, and Colorado League of Charter Schools, testified to amend
the bill.
02:41:53 PM  
Sun Richardson, representing the Colorado Youth Advisory Council, testified in support of the bill.
02:43:28 PM  
Gabrielle Hooper, representing herself, testified in support of the bill.
02:45:58 PM  
Autumn Brooks, representing Clear Creek School District Re-1, testified in support of the bill.
02:49:11 PM  
Meighen Lovelace, representing the Colorado Cross Disability Coalition, testified in support of the bill.

HB23-1009 - Referred to Senate Appropriations


02:56:12 PM  
Senator Moreno, sponsor, presented House Bill 23-1009, which concerns measures to improve services for students who use substances. He provided opening comments on the bill and answered questions from the committee.
03:06:11 PM  
Ellen Velez, representing Peer Assistance Services, testified in support of the bill.
03:06:14 PM  
Autumn Brooks, representing Clear Creek School District Re-1, testified in support of the bill.
